Armyworms

Further Information

Click to open/close

Armyworms are highly destructive leaf-feeding pests that attack crops in large colonies. The larvae infest a wide range of crops including shallots, chili, maize, and soybeans by devouring leaf tissues until only the veins remain, and often target growing points, leading to severe yield loss.
